A little over a week ago, I finally got Romancing SaGa for the PS2 which is remake of the "Super Famicom" game. A game never released here for the Snes. All I can say is this version is much better than the original. I don't mean just because of graphics or the fact it's in a language I can understand. Everything is better. Well except for the lack of Natalie. What really stands out is the battle system. It's a lot more defined and involved than the original battle system. The original battle system was manageable yes, but honestly wasn't that great. I love the BP system because it makes defend and using weaker attacks a very useful strategy over all.
